Summary
If you make $28,000 a year living in the region of Alberta, Canada, you will be taxed $8,186. That means that your net pay will be $19,814 per year, or $1,651 per month. Your average tax rate is 29.2% and your marginal tax rate is 30.5%. This marginal tax rate means that your immediate additional income will be taxed at this rate. For instance, an increase of $100 in your salary will be taxed $30.46, hence, your net pay will only increase by $69.54.
Bonus Example
A $1,000 bonus will generate an extra $695 of net incomes. A $5,000 bonus will generate an extra $3,477 of net incomes.
